For the cohost folks: moving your markdown formatted posts over
So, for any of my fellow Cohosters, you probably have an archive (or in my case, a git repo...) of Cohost posts that you want to re-upload here, in which case, those posts are probably in markdown format.
I've learned through trial-and-error that there's two ways to deal with this:
1) For the more tech-savvy, use a command-line tool like pandoc. This is how I re-uploaded my stories on Dreamwidth.
Using pandoc to turn Markdown into HTML that you can just copy-and-paste into DW is pretty simple:
pandoc Skykomish_Never_sleeps.md -o Skykomish_Never_sleeps.html
2) As this docs page states, you can place a !markdown directive a the beginning of the entry, and then proceed to just write markdown.

You can also turn on the beta for new entries page. Once you do that, there'll be a dropdown menu that lets you choose if your entry is formatted in HTML, Markdown, etc.
